Bukuya Alpine Eco Centre
Bukuya is a small village nestled high in the Nausori Highlands that surround Nadi. Getting there is a half the fun, with an unsealed road winding up to the highlands that offers spectacular views and photo opportunities looking back at Nadi and its offshore island groups of Mamanuca and Yasawa. In the hills, the climate is less sticky and not so hot, but not really "alpine" !. This is budget, homestay-style accommodation with basic facilities and amenities. However, it offers the opportunity of really experiencing the real Fiji, to meet the friendliest people on earth, and participate in local activities and everyday life, such as eel-fishing, pig-hunting, waterfall trek and birdwatching. It is an experience you will always remember, but is not the destination for those looking for resort or 5-star accommodation. Run by the village itself, the Eco Centre has modest accommodation and camping or homestays in the village itself can be arranged.
